Microsoft's antivirus scored full marks on every category, and may even beat out that one program you keep recommending to everybody.
Â
For a long time, it was common advice to never make do with programs that Microsoft offered you.
Whether it wanted you to scan your PC with its Defender antivirus or to browse the web with Edge, people suggested forgoing these offers and download a third-party offering instead.
Â
However, Microsoft is slowly showing the world that it, too, can make a quality product.
Â
A recent report by AV-TEST revealed that not only does Microsoft Defender perform well, it actually outperforms many highly-recommended antiviruses...

Using a Google sheet for content marketing planning and SEO management is one of the most effective ways you can keep your strategy on track.
Â
It’s true that there are tons of powerful technology tools out there for different content marketing needs.
But Google sheets should not be underestimated among them.
Â
Google sheets provide a free, centralized, collaborative place where you can have total control over how you build your tracking systems and manage your content.
Â
Plus, you don’t have to start from scratch if you want to make Google sheets part of your content marketing management system.
Â
There are tried-and-true templates available for all kinds of content marketing and SEO needs, and this guide puts some of the best ones all in one place.

In this guide, you’ll discover how to create and use NFTs for business.
Â
You’ll learn about common uses, types, platforms, and more.
Â
The first immediate benefit to creating an NFT for your business is that NFTs prove authorship.
Â
NFTs can also be used for access.
Whether you’re selling access to a membership, community, or event, anything that you could normally sell digital tickets to online, by associating an NFT with the point of access, you’re giving your audience a much smoother experience.
